哈希竞猜骗局,区块链技术的潜在威胁与应对策略区块链哈希竞猜骗局
本文目录导读:
区块链技术自2009年比特币诞生以来,已经成为全球范围内最炙手可热的技术创新之一,它的去中心化特性、不可篡改性和不可伪造性使其在加密货币、智能合约、供应链管理和身份验证等领域得到了广泛应用,尽管区块链技术在安全性方面有着诸多优势,但其底层哈希函数的特性却为一些不法分子提供了可乘之机,哈希竞猜骗局作为一种新型的区块链攻击手段,正在逐渐成为区块链领域的一个重要威胁,本文将深入探讨哈希竞猜骗局的原理、影响以及应对策略。
哈希函数与区块链的基本原理
哈希函数是区块链技术的核心组件之一,它是一种数学函数,能够将任意长度的输入数据映射到一个固定长度的固定长度输出,通常称为哈希值或摘要,哈希函数具有以下几个关键特性:
- 确定性:相同的输入数据始终产生相同的哈希值。
- 不可逆性:已知哈希值无法推导出原始输入数据。
- 抗碰撞性:不同的输入数据产生不同的哈希值。
- 高效性:哈希函数的计算速度快,适合大规模数据处理。
在区块链中,哈希函数被用于生成区块的哈希值,每个区块包含一系列交易记录、前一个区块的哈希值以及一些随机数,所有这些数据经过哈希函数处理后,生成一个固定长度的哈希值,作为该区块的唯一标识符,这个哈希值不仅确保了区块的数据完整性,还为整个区块链的分布式系统提供了不可篡改的特性。
哈希竞猜骗局的原理与操作流程
哈希竞猜骗局是一种利用哈希函数特性进行的攻击手段,攻击者通过猜测哈希函数的输入参数,使得生成的哈希值满足特定的条件,从而达到攻击目的,这种攻击方式的核心在于对哈希函数的输入空间进行探索,以找到满足特定条件的输入值。
猜测哈希值的后缀
在哈希竞猜骗局中,攻击者通常会尝试猜测哈希值的后缀部分,攻击者可能希望找到一个哈希值,其后四位是"0000",由于哈希函数的抗逆性,攻击者无法直接推导出满足条件的输入值,他们只能通过暴力枚举的方式,尝试不同的输入参数,直到找到一个满足条件的哈希值。
时间戳攻击
时间戳攻击是哈希竞猜骗局中的一种常见手法,攻击者通过控制哈希函数的输入参数,使得生成的哈希值包含特定的时间戳信息,攻击者可能试图在某个特定的时间点,生成一个包含当前时间戳的哈希值,由于哈希函数的抗逆性,攻击者无法直接推导出满足条件的输入值,因此只能通过暴力枚举的方式进行攻击。
区块高度预测
在以太坊等区块链项目中,哈希竞猜骗局还被用于预测未来区块的高度,攻击者通过猜测哈希函数的输入参数,使得生成的哈希值满足特定的条件,从而预测出未来区块的高度,这种攻击方式对以太坊的交易费用系统和激励机制构成了严重威胁。
哈希竞猜骗局的后果
哈希竞猜骗局虽然是一种技术上的攻击手段,但其后果却非常严重,攻击者通过这种技术手段,可以对区块链系统的安全性造成重大威胁,以下是一些常见的后果:
- 资金损失:攻击者通过预测区块高度或哈希值,可以提前参与交易,获得不正当的交易机会,从而获得大量资金。
- 系统漏洞暴露:哈希竞猜骗局的实施,往往暴露了哈希函数的某些特性或漏洞,攻击者通过攻击,可以迫使区块链项目方改进哈希函数,提升系统的安全性。
- 信任危机:哈希竞猜骗局的实施,会严重削弱区块链技术的信任基础,攻击者的行为会使得区块链技术的去中心化特性受到质疑,进而影响其在公众中的接受度。
哈希竞猜骗局的应对策略
面对哈希竞猜骗局这一威胁,区块链项目方和相关技术开发者需要采取一系列应对措施,以下是一些有效的应对策略:
改进哈希函数
为了提高哈希函数的安全性,区块链项目方可以考虑采用更先进的哈希函数算法,以太坊正在使用的Ethash算法,已经通过改进抗量子计算能力,提升了其安全性,还可以通过增加哈希函数的轮数或引入随机数生成器等技术,进一步提高哈希函数的安全性。
加强监管
哈希竞猜骗局的实施,往往需要一定的技术背景和资源支持,为了防止这种攻击手段的实施,相关监管机构可以加强对区块链技术的监管,限制不法分子的使用和开发,还可以通过制定相关法律法规,对区块链技术的使用和应用进行规范。
提高哈希函数的抗量子计算能力
随着量子计算技术的发展,传统的哈希函数算法将面临越来越大的威胁,为了应对这一挑战,哈希函数需要具备更强的抗量子计算能力,Grover算法可以用于加速哈希函数的破解过程,哈希函数需要具备更强的抗Grover算法的能力。
加密货币的去中心化
哈希竞猜骗局的实施,对加密货币的去中心化特性构成了严重威胁,为了防止这种攻击手段的实施,加密货币的开发方可以采取以下措施:
- 提高哈希函数的安全性:通过改进哈希函数算法,提高其抗破解和抗攻击的能力。
- 增加哈希函数的轮数:通过增加哈希函数的轮数,提高其计算复杂度,使得暴力枚举攻击变得不可行。
- 引入随机数生成器:通过引入高质量的随机数生成器,提高哈希函数的抗逆性,使得攻击者无法通过猜测输入参数来达到攻击目的。
哈希竞猜骗局是一种利用哈希函数特性进行的攻击手段,对区块链技术的安全性构成了严重威胁,攻击者通过猜测哈希函数的输入参数,使得生成的哈希值满足特定的条件,从而达到攻击目的,尽管哈希竞猜骗局的实施对区块链技术的安全性构成了威胁,但通过改进哈希函数、加强监管、提高哈希函数的抗量子计算能力等措施,可以有效应对这种威胁,随着区块链技术的不断发展,如何提高哈希函数的安全性,将是区块链技术研究和开发的重要方向。
哈希竞猜骗局,区块链技术的潜在威胁与应对策略区块链哈希竞猜骗局,



发表评论